Top 10 best-selling games in Japan for April
Posted on 14 years ago by Brian(@NE_Brian) in DS, News, Wii | 2 Comments
These sales are based on Famitsu data from March 29th to April 25th…
1. [Wii] New Super Mario Bros. Wii – 144,966 / 3,732,721
2. [PS3] Fist of the North Star: Warriors – 137,863 / 523,414
3. [PS3] Pro Baseball Spirits 2010 – 133,804 / NEW
4. [DS] Etrian Odyssey III – 125,136 / NEW
5. [PSP] Pro Baseball Spirits 2010 – 123,846 / NEW
6. [DS] Tomodachi Collection – 99,524 / 3,185,362
7. [DS] Pokemon Ranger: Tracks of Light – 83,141 / 413,942
8. [Wii] Wii Fit Plus – 70,967 / 1,858,827
9. [PS3] NieR Replicant – 64,818 / NEW
10. [PS3] Yakuza 4 – 57,638 / 538,264

Cuthbert on X-Scape, possibility of creating another Star Fox
Posted on 14 years ago by Brian(@NE_Brian) in DS, General Nintendo, News | 4 Comments
First, Q-Games’ Dylan Cuthbert discussed X-Scape…
“X was a very special game for me. It was the first game I made for Nintendo. Star Fox is very much a Miyamoto group game. X’s themes are a little more adult, a little more science fiction based. It’s a bit of a self challenge, to go back to something you made 20 years ago and going through all the old ideas and trying to remake them with the experience I have now. As a challenge that was more fun for us than doing another Star Fox. It let’s us explore more themes because it’s not a major franchise title.”
Mr. Cuthbert was also asked about the possibility of creating another Star Fox title…
“We’re willing to do any game for Nintendo. It’s up to them.”
